The search engine optimisation (Search engine optimisation) approach consists of designing, writing, and coding net pages to improve the likelihood that they will appear at the top of search engine results for targeted keyword phrases. Several so-referred to as Search engine marketing professionals claim to have reversed engineered search engine algorithms and use strategically designed "doorway pages" and cloaking technologies to sustain long-phrase search positions. Regardless of all of these claims, the fundamentals of a profitable search engine campaign have not changed in all the years we have supplied these services.

To get the greatest overall, long-phrase search engine positions, three elements should be present on a net web page:

Text element

Link element

Recognition element

All of the major search engines (AltaVista, Quickly Search, Google, Lycos, MSN Search and other Inktomi-based engines) use these components as a element of their search engine algorithms. Websites that have (a) all of the elements on their net pages, and (b) have optimal levels of all the components execute nicely in the search engines general.

Text component

Considering that the search engines create lists of words and phrases on URL's, then it naturally follows that in order to do properly on the search engines, you ought to place these words on your internet pages in the strategic HTML tags.

The most important component of the text element of a search engine algorithm is keyword choice. In order for your target audience to find your internet site on the search engines, your pages ought to consist of keyword phrases that match the phrases your target audience is typing into search queries.

When you have determined the best keyword phrases to use on your internet pages, you will need to have to place them inside your HTML tags. Search engines do not spot emphasis on the exact same HTML tags. For example, Inktomi reads Meta tags Google ignores Meta tags. As a result, in order to do properly on the entire search engines, it is best to spot search phrases in all of the HTML tags achievable, with out keyword stuffing. So no matter what the search engine algorithm is, you know that your search phrases are contained in your documents

Link element

The method of placing keyword-rich text in your net pages is useless if the search engine spiders have no way of discovering that text. The way your pages are linked to every other, and the way your internet web site is linked to other net internet sites, does impact your search engine positions.

Even though search engine spiders are strong data-gathering applications, HTML coding or scripting can avert a spider from properly crawling your pages. Examples of website navigation schemes that can be problematic are:

1. Poor HTML coding on all navigation schemes: Browsers (Netscape and Explorer) can display internet pages with sloppy HTML coding search engine spiders are not as forgiving as browsers are.

two. JavaScript: All of the main search engines can't stick to hyperlinks embedded inside of JavaScript, such as but not restricted to mouseovers, arrays, and drop-down menus. Note: Even although reliable designer resources claim search-engine friendly scripts exist, many of them are untested and unproven.

3. Dynamic or database-driven web pages: Pages that are created by means of scripts, databases, and/or have a?, &, $, =, +, or % in the URL can present spider "traps."

4. Flash: Currently, none of the search engines can comply with the links embedded in Flash documents.

Consequently, to make certain that the spiders have the indicates to record the data on your net pages, we suggest possessing two types of navigation on a net web page: a single that pleases your finish users, and one particular that the search engine spiders can stick to.

Acceptance element

The reputation element of a search engine algorithm consists of numerous sub-components:

Link popularity

Click-through popularity

Internet web page reputation

Attaining an optimal reputation element is not simply getting as numerous links as achievable to a internet site. The good quality of the internet sites linking to your web site holds more "weight" than the quantity of internet sites linking to your website. Given that Yahoo is the most frequently visited internet site on the web, a link from Yahoo to your internet website carries far far more "weight" than a link from a smaller sized, less visited site. Other outstanding internet sites that can assist produce superb recognition are LookSmart, the Open Directory, and About.com. Non-competitive, sector-specific sites (such as javascript.com) are also excellent hyperlink development sources.

Obtaining hyperlinks from other web sites is not sufficient to maintain optimal recognition. The main search engines and directories are measuring how typically finish customers are clicking on the hyperlinks to your site and how long they are staying on your internet site (i.e., reading your internet pages). They are also measuring how frequently end customers return to your internet site. All of these measurements constitute a site's click-through popularity.

The search engines and directories measure both link popularity (high quality and quantity of hyperlinks) and click-through acceptance to decide the general acceptance component of a net web site.
